On a manufacturing floor, tooling, jigs, fixtures and gauges move between lines, shifts and the tool room constantly, and a missing or out-of-calibration fixture can halt a line or scrap a batch. Spreadsheets can’t keep up with shift handovers, and an uncalibrated gauge that slips into use is a quality risk. Tool tracking ties every tool and gauge to a register with checkout, availability and calibration due dates, so operators grab the right, in-cal tooling and supervisors see instantly what’s on which line. For plant managers, that means fewer line stoppages, cleaner quality audits and tooling that is accounted for across every shift.
